Brand
Triumph
Model
Tiger 800 XR
Category
Adventure
Production Years
2015-2020
Engine Displacement
800.0 ccm (48.82 cubic inches)
Max Power
93.9 HP (68.5 kW) @ 9500 RPM
Max Torque
79.0 Nm (8.1 kgf-m or 58.3 ft.lbs) @ 8050 RPM
Top Speed
210 km/h (130 mph)
Weight
199.0 kg (438.7 pounds)
